diff --git a/changelog b/changelog
new file mode 100644
--- /dev/null
+++ b/changelog
@@ -0,0 +1,35 @@
+-*-change-log-*-
+
+1.3.0.2  Nov 2013
+        * Update package description to Cabal 1.10 format
+        * Add support for GHC 7.8
+        * Drop support for GHCs older than GHC 7.0.1
+        * Add `/since: .../` annotations to Haddock comments
+        * Add changelog
+
+1.3.0.1  Sep 2012
+        * No changes
+
+1.3.0.0  Feb 2012
+        * Add instances for `Fixed`, `a->b` and `Version`
+
+1.3.0.1  Sep 2011
+        * Disable SafeHaskell for GHC 7.2
+
+1.2.0.0  Sep 2011
+        * New function `force`
+        * New operator `$!!`
+        * Add SafeHaskell support
+        * Dropped dependency on containers
+
+1.1.0.2  Nov 2010
+        * Improve Haddock documentation
+
+1.1.0.1  Oct 2010
+        * Enable support for containers-0.4.x
+
+1.1.0.0  Nov 2009
+        * Major rewrite
+
+1.0.0.0  Nov 2009
+        * Initial release
